molecularNote | The transgene is designed with a bidirectional tetracycline operator between two cytomegalovirus (CMV) minimal promoters in the opposite orientation. One CMV promoter drives expression of hemagglutinin (HA)-tagged, modified rat transforming growth factor, beta receptor I gene, while the other drives expression of an enhanced green fluorescent protein sequence. Tgfbr1 is made constitutively active by the introduction of a T204D mutation. |
